Waterfalls and Black Sands: Nature’s Masterpieces

Our first major stop was the Seljalandsfoss waterfall, a towering cascade that plummets 60 meters from the cliffs of the Eyjafjallajökull volcano. The sheer force of the water was a humbling sight, a reminder of nature’s unyielding power. We ventured behind the waterfall, where the mist enveloped us in a cold embrace, a familiar sensation for someone accustomed to the icy winds of the Arctic.

Next, we visited the hidden gem of Gljufrabui, a waterfall tucked away in a narrow canyon. Its secluded beauty was a testament to the secrets that nature holds, waiting to be discovered by those willing to seek them out. Filip’s guidance ensured we didn’t miss this stunning spot, and his insights into the geological forces at play added depth to the experience.

The journey continued to the Reynisfjara black sand beach, where the Atlantic waves crashed against the volcanic shore with a relentless rhythm. The basalt columns and sea stacks stood like sentinels, guarding the coast against the encroaching sea. It was a landscape both alien and familiar, reminiscent of the stark beauty of the polar regions I had explored.
